Units of the 1st Separate Center of the Unmanned Systems Forces struck the corvette, a carrier of guided missile weapons.
Madyar noted that at around 6:35 a.m., the ship was located in the Veleshchinsky Dry Dock in Kronstadt, widely considered the "cradle of the Russian Navy." The Project 20380 corvette, built in 2011 and commissioned in 2013, was undergoing scheduled repairs since February 2026.
Brovdi emphasized that the vessel "has an enchanting history of travels and adventures" along NATO borders and had escorted Russia's "shadow oil fleet." He also mentioned the corvette's involvement in the "triumphant ramming of the research vessel Admiral Vladimirsky."
"How did it go back in 1921 during the bloodily suppressed sailors' uprising? 'All power to the Soviets, and not to the parties!' Metaphorically but symbolically, it is a slap in the face to the dictatorial regime," the commander added.
[Madyar referred to Kronstadt rebellion of March 1921 - an uprising by thousands of Soviet sailors, soldiers, and workers at the Kronstadt naval fortress against the Bolshevik government. Hundreds of sailors were killed in the fighting, and thousands more were summarily executed or sent to Gulags camps - ed.]
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y confirmed that Defense Forces struck Russian targets in St. Petersburg and Tambov Oblast overnight on June 3.
Specifically, the St. Petersburg Oil Terminal, located approximately 1,100 kilometers from the Ukrainian border, was attacked. Ukraine's Special Operations Forces clarified that it is one of the largest oil terminals on the Baltic Sea, featuring 31 reservoirs with a total capacity of 324,000 cubic meters.
Overnight and into the morning of June 3, St. Petersburg was targeted by UAVs, with reports of large-scale fires in the city, particularly near the port and the oil terminal. Local authorities confirmed strikes on "infrastructure facilities" and damage across three city districts.
The attack took place on the opening day of the St. Petersburg International Economic Forum, where Russian dictator Vladimir Putin is scheduled to speak.
